Asiatic Beans

Abstract: Vigna species of the subgenus Ceratotropis constitute an economically important group of cultivated and wild species, of which a rich diversity occurs in Asian subcontinent. Progress in genetic improvement in Vigna species has been made mainly by conventional breeding methods. “…At 10 sec sonication time, a large number of microwounds were produced across the tissue, which permitted the Agrobacterium to penetrate deeper and more completely throughout the tissue as compared to the natural infection obtained during co-cultivation, thus improving the bacterial colonization and infection of the tissue [ 36 ]. Trick and Finer [ 37 ] observed under SEM that ultrasound treatment produced small wounds, which allowed Agrobacterium access to internal plant tissue. Sahoo and Jaiwal [ 38 ] reported that the sonication treatment has the potential to increase transformation efficiency by improving penetration of Agrobacterium cells into the cell layers beneath the epidermis of the cotyledonary node region.…”

“…Because of its high protein content and perfect combination of all nutrients, including proteins (25-26 %), carbohydrates (60 %), fat (1.5 %), minerals, amino acids and vitamins (Karamany 2006), it is extensively used in Asia especially in India and now also grown in the Southern United States, the West Indies, Japan and other tropics and subtropics (Delic et al 2009). Viral and fungal pathogens lead to severe yield losses in blackgram (Sahoo and Jaiwal 2008) and to overcome this problem, attempts have been made to obtain resistant cultivars either by conventional breeding or genetic transformation. Due to limited genetic variation among cultivated accessions and sexual incompatibility with wild relatives, genetic engineering is a good alternative for conventional breeding.…”
